The Legal Process of Obtaining a Driver's License in Poland

For those really thinking about obtaining their driver's license, it is crucial to follow the legal pathway. Below is a detailed guide detailing the steps included:

StepDescription
1Eligibility: Lekcje Jazdy W Polsce Ensure you satisfy the minimum age requirement (18 years for Category B-- passenger cars and trucks).
2Driver Education: Enroll in a recognized driving school to get the required training.
3Medical checkup: Undergo a medical checkup to ensure you are fit to drive.
4Theory Test: Pass the theoretical exam on traffic laws, signs, and safe driving practices.
5Dry run: Successfully finish the useful driving test to demonstrate your driving skills.
6Application Submission: Submit your application for a driver's license, along with required documents, at the local authority workplace.
7Payment of Fees: Pay the appropriate fees for the tests and processing.
8Get Your License: Once all actions are finished, you will get your Polish driver's license.

The entire process can take numerous months, and it requires commitment and commitment to finding out the rules of the road.

Frequently Asked Questions

1. Can I drive in Poland with a foreign driver's license?

Yes, people can drive in Poland with a foreign driver's license for as much as 6 months. After this period, a Polish driver's license is required.

2. What documents do I require to get a Polish driver's license?

Normally, candidates will require:

  • A completed application type
  • Valid identification (passport or ID card)
  • Medical evaluation certificate
  • Proof of residency
  • Photographs
  • Fees for the process

3. How long does it take to obtain a driver's license in Poland?

The timeline can differ but generally ranges from 3 to 6 months, depending upon the individual's preparedness and scheduling for tests.
